2018 year model

The Aldebaran MGL is the ultimate choice for anglers seeking unparalleled lightweight performance. Its MGL spool enables effortless casting of small baits, while the reel's total weight of just 4.8 ounces makes it the lightest in Shimano's lineup, ensuring all-day comfort on the water.

X SHIP

X-Ship provides improved gear durability. By supporting the pinion gear on both ends with bearings, the pinion gear maintains precise alignment with the drive gear. This means the gears will stay in the same position under the heaviest loads. The added benefit is that friction between the spool shaft and gear are eliminated. This will enhance the casting performance of the reel with lighter lures, and allow for longer casts.

HAGANE BODY

The HAGANE Body is a metal reel body with high rigidity. The body rigidity and impact resistance virtually eliminates body flexing. The result transforms the angler's actions directly into cranking power. It's efficiency through strength.

MGL SPOOL

In the development of the second-generation Magnum Light spool, we succeeded in drilling a hole in the side of the spool, which had been considered technically impossible until now. This has achieved a reduction of approximately 10% in the moment of inertia compared to our company's spools, and has realized a significant increase in casting distance.

SILENT TUNE

By applying a slight pressure to the bearing holding the spool, it reduces the vibration of the bearing during high speed rotation. This realizes further quietness improvement during casting. Rise of spool rotation has become even smoother.
